Police, USC Announce $125K Reward For Information In Double Murder

LOS ANGELES (CBS) — Police and USC officials announced Friday afternoon a $125,000 reward for information leading to the killer of two electrical engineering graduate students from China.

Officers sent to the 2700 block of Raymond Avenue near West 27th Street shortly after 1 a.m. Wednesday found Ying Wu and Ming Qu, who had been shot several times, according to Sgt. Carlton Brown of the Los Angeles Police Department's Southwest Station.

Paramedics took the 23-year-old victims to a hospital, where they were pronounced dead, Brown said.
